Euroclear has selected BT as one of its key providers of secure messaging services to facilitate two-way client communication through its new Common Communication Interface (CCI).
“As we move forward in creating our single-access gateway to Euroclear, we are pleased with BT’s offer in meeting our requirements for reliable providers of secure and cost-effective messaging services for our new Common Communication Interface,” says Wim Claeys, Managing Director and Head of Strategic Programmes at Euroclear.
“We are delighted to be selected by Euroclear as one of their key providers of secure messaging services for the new Common Communication Interface,” says Kevin Covington, Executive Vice President of Product & Business Development at BT Radianz.
“This new contract builds on BT’s ten years of delivering the SettleNET service for secure CREST connectivity and five years of BT Radianz delivering connectivity to Euroclear Bank and Euroclear France clients.”
